A Brand Born Outside the Fashion System
Chrome Hearts was founded in 1988 in Los Angeles by Richard Stark, not as a fashion experiment but as a functional solution. The brand originally focused on producing durable leather motorcycle gear that reflected the rugged lifestyle of bikers and creatives.
Because Chrome Hearts was not born inside the traditional fashion system, it never adopted its rules. There were no fashion weeks, no trend forecasts, and no pressure to scale rapidly. This independence shaped the brand’s identity and allowed it to evolve naturally.

Why Timeless Design Outperforms Trends
Chrome Hearts does not redesign itself every season. Its visual language—crosses, fleur-de-lis, daggers, gothic lettering—has remained consistent for decades.
This consistency creates timeless relevance. A Chrome Hearts ring or jacket purchased today will feel just as current years from now. In contrast, trend-based luxury items often lose relevance as styles shift.
By resisting trends, Chrome Hearts allows its products to age with the wearer rather than with fashion cycles.
Jewelry That Evolves With the Wearer
Chrome Hearts jewelry is designed to be worn daily, not stored away. Made from solid .925 sterling silver, pieces develop a natural patina over time.
This aging process adds character rather than reducing value. Scratches and wear marks become part of the story, turning jewelry into personal artifacts rather than disposable accessories.
For many collectors, Chrome Hearts jewelry becomes irreplaceable—not because of cost, but because of emotional attachment.

Limited Production as a Philosophy
Chrome Hearts intentionally limits production. This is not a marketing tactic—it is a philosophical choice. The brand values quality control and creative freedom over volume.
Many items are available only at specific locations, and some designs are never reproduced. This scarcity enhances desirability while preserving the integrity of the brand.
Ownership feels meaningful because it is not easily accessible.
Retail Spaces That Reflect Identity
Chrome Hearts stores are immersive environments rather than standard retail spaces. Each location is uniquely designed with custom furniture, architectural elements, and artistic details.
These stores feel personal, almost private, reinforcing the idea that Chrome Hearts is not mass luxury. The retail experience reflects the same values as the products: craft, individuality, and depth.
